| 1 | Erlotinib usage after prior treatment with gefitinib in advanced non-small cell lung cancer: A clinical perspective and review of published literature显示文摘Erlotinib and gefitinib are among the most widely researched, used and available molecularly targeted therapies for treatment of advanced non-small cell lung cancer(NSCLC). They are both tyrosine kinase inhibitors(TKIs) of the epidermal growth factor receptor(EGFR). In the past decade, there have been reports on clinical benefit from use of erlotinib after gefitinib failure in NSCLC patients. A review of published literature on this focussed topic is provided herein. Pooled analysis of published literature shows that majority of patients were female(60.6%), non-smokers(64.5%), had adenocarcinoma histology(88.3%) and were of East Asian ethnicity(92.3%). Presence of sensitizing EGFR mutation was detected in 48.4% of subjects. Disease control rates with prior gefitinib therapy and with subsequent erlotinib treatment were 79.4% and 45.4% respectively. Based upon our review, the most important predictive factor for clinical benefit from erlotinib identified was previous response to gefitinib. | 3 | Interconversion of two commonly used performance tools: An analysis of 5844 paired assessments in 1501 lung cancer patients显示文摘AIM To establish the Karnofsky performance status(KPS) categories which would facilitate the interconversion of the KPS scale to the Eastern Cooperative Oncology Group(ECOG) performance status(PS) scale.METHODS This was a retrospective analysis of all patients attending the lung cancer clinic at a tertiary care center over a 5-year period(September 2009 to August 2014). All patients were assessed with both KPS and ECOG PS scales at each visit. Correlation between KPS and ECOG PS was assessed using Spearman's correlation coefficient. KPS categories equivalent to ECOG PS scores were compared using hit rate and weighted kappa(κw).RESULTS A total of 1501 patients were assessed over the study period, providing 5844 paired KPS and ECOG PS assessments. The study cohort had a mean(standard deviation; SD) age of 58.4(10.8) years, with the majority being current or ex-smokers(76.9%) and males(82.3%). Non-small cell lung cancer was the most common histological type(n = 1196, 79.7%) with the majority having advanced(stage ⅢB/Ⅳ) disease(83.4%). Mean baseline KPS and ECOG PS scores were 77.6(SD = 14.4) and 1.5(SD = 1) respectively. The most frequent KPS score was 80(29%), and the most frequent ECOG PS score was 1(43%). The overall correlation between KPS and ECOG PS was good(Spearman r =-0.84, P < 0.0001) but ranged from-0.727 to-0.972 between visits. KPS categories derived from our cohort [10-40(ECOG 4), 50-60(ECOG 3), 70(ECOG 2), 80-90(ECOG 1), 100(ECOG 0)] performed better [hit rate 78.1%, κw = 0.749(0.736-0.762) P < 0.0001] than those suggested in the past literature.CONCLUSION The current study provides the largest set of paired KPS-ECOG assessments to date. We suggest that the KPS categories 10-40, 50-60, 70, 80-90, and 100 are equivalent to ECOG PS categories of 4, 3, 2, 1, and 0 respectively. | Kuruswamy Thurai Prasad Harpreet Kaur Valliappan Muthu Ashutosh Nath Aggarwal Digambar Behera Navneet Singh | 2018 | World Journal of Clinical Oncology2018,9,7: | 2 |

| 6 | Extrapulmonary small cell carcinoma of lymph node: Pooled analysis of all reported cases显示文摘AIM: To study clinical outcomes and management of lymph nodes extrapulmonary small cell carcinoma(LNEPSCC). METHODS: Herein, we perform a systematic search of published literature in the PubMed and EMBASE databases for studies describing LNEPSCC. For uniformity of reporting, LNEPSCC was staged as limited if it involved either single lymph node station or if surgery with curative intent had been undertaken. The disease was staged extensive if it involved two or more lymph node regions.RESULTS: The systematic literature review yielded eight descriptions(n = 14) involving cervical, submandibular and inguinal lymph nodes. Eleven(64.7%) patients had limited disease(LD) and six(35.3%) had extensive disease(ED) at presentation. Chemotherapy(n = 6, 35.3%) or surgery(n = 4, 23.5%) were the most common form of treatment given to these patients. Complete response was achieved in 12(70.6%) of the patients. Median(interquartile range) progression free survival and overall survival was 15(7-42) mo and 22(12.75-42) mo respectively. Of the three illustrative cases, two patients each had ED at presentation and achieved complete remission with platinum based combination chemotherapy.CONCLUSION: LNEPSCC is a rare disease with less than 15 reported cases in world literature. Surgical resection with curative intent is feasible in those with LD while platinum based combination chemoradiation is associated with favorable outcomes in patients with ED. Prognosis of LNEPSCC is better than that of small cell lung cancer in general. | Inderpaul Singh Sehgal Harpreet Kaur Sahajal Dhooria Amanjit Bal Nalini Gupta Digambar Behera Navneet Singh | 2016 | World Journal of Clinical Oncology2016,7,3: | 1 |

| 14 | Optimization of CMOS Repeater Driven Interconnect RC Line Using Genetic Algorithm显示文摘In this work, optimization of complementary metal oxide semiconductor(CMOS) repeater driven interconnect resistive-capacitive(RC) line is carried out using genetic algorithm(GA). This work is aimed at powerdelay-product(PDP) minimization of RC interconnect at 180 nm technology node. The algorithm simultaneously optimizes the values of supply voltage, number of repeaters and repeater width for delay and PDP minimization.The accuracy of results obtained is verified by simulations from Cadence virtuoso tool. For delay minimization,comparison of GA results with previous results of the literature shows an improvement of 44.4% in the value of the optimal number of repeaters required. This improvement is obtained by increasing the repeater size, which also increases power dissipation, so a tradeoff has also been achieved in terms of PDP minimization. The comparison of PDP results obtained in this work, with the results at 70, 100, and 130 nm technologies from literature shows improvement in optimal number of repeaters required. The results of algorithm and simulations are in good agreement and demonstrate the validity of proposed algorithm. | KAUR Jasmeet GILL Sandeep Singh KAUR Navneet | 2017 | Journal of Shanghai Jiaotong university(Science)2017,22,2: | 0 |
